Dear Micronetters, Does anyone know of a good, and hopefully low-cost/free, software for managing a fleet of Android-based Tablet devices? We want to hand-out inexpensive electronic devices to some of our students, but the whole enterprise will fall apart without some sort of management system. Ideally, we're looking for a software that would give us a central console to manage user accounts (one user per each unique device), push documents to the device filesystem, and track device location. Any ideas?
